Girls Varsity Soccer Wins 4-1 Over Peru

By Keisha Wright | Sep 19, 2023 9:49 PM

The Wabash Girls Varsity Soccer team wins 4-1 in their final conference game of the season at Peru. Junior goalkeeper Olivia Braun had 10 saves on the night and did a great job for the Lady Apaches. Defense was also lead by senior Kiana Jones, Juniors Macy VonUhl and Graci Napier and sophomore Jaycee Jones. Freshman Lily Meadows provided 40+ minutes off the bench to contribute defensively too. K.Jones pushed forward offensively tonight and provided scoring opportunities the entire game for Wabash. Senior Natalie Adams put away 2 goals night, one unassisted and one penalty shot that she earned after being taken down in the box. Junior Kait Honeycutt also scored 2 goals tonight, one unassisted and the other a one-touch volley to the back of the net off a K. Jones corner. Shots on goal tonight also by juniors Abbi Hipskind and Emma Weaver and sophomores Logan Wright and Raegan Jones. Wabash improves to 5-4-1 on the season and are right back in action tomorrow night at Tri-Central.
